The rule treats vehicles above standard passenger thresholds as restricted in residential zones; the practical effect is that the legal basecamp is Snow Canyon State Park (Utah State Parks, 6 mi out), which offers Electric on 31 sites; water at host station on rigs up to 40 ft at $30/night. St. George is the Zion National Park primary gateway and Utah's sunniest city at 250+ sunny days per year.
Population is ~95K, founded 1861, elevation 2860 ft, climate hot desert (Köppen BWh). Two adjacent public lands extend the playbook for renters whose trip plan extends beyond city limits: Snow Canyon State Park and Zion National Park. The two arterials worth scenic-drive time are Zion-Mount Carmel Scenic Byway (UT-9) and Kolob Terrace Road. Tank-dump access lives at Snow Canyon State Park; propane at U-Haul of St. George on 450 N Bluff St, St. George, UT 84770.
The calendar moment that swings local availability is St. George Marathon on first weekend of October — all in-region camping books out 90+ days ahead. Aim for Mid-October through April; skip June through September. The single most expensive mistake locals see arriving rigs make is driving zion-mount carmel tunnel in a vehicle over 11'4 wide or 13'1 tall, and it tunnel requires permit and traffic-stop escort for any oversized vehicle ($15).

Read before you park
Parking ordinances that bite RVs
RVs may not park on residential streets longer than 48 hours; commercial vehicles restricted in residence zones
Citation: St. George Code Sec. 6-3-3
What this means for you: Practical impact: a typical Class A or longer Class C cannot stay overnight on residential streets in St. George. Plan to be at Snow Canyon State Park by the posted cutoff.

The mistake renters make
Avoid this trap
Driving Zion-Mount Carmel Tunnel in a vehicle over 11'4 wide or 13'1 tall
Tunnel requires permit and traffic-stop escort for any oversized vehicle ($15)
